Transaction 8285140810147e18c21e04e92493ee6e4a793026946e4bc8e0e24fe6978060da

1 Input
2 Outputs
  • 8285140810147e18c21e04e92493ee6e4a793026946e4bc8e0e24fe6978060da:0
  • value  12898197
    address  2NFXAFaoX35HzmFDvX6pEyw4hVNM4qws4CQ
  • 8285140810147e18c21e04e92493ee6e4a793026946e4bc8e0e24fe6978060da:1
  • value  1000000
    address  2NDQkt34mkNqL17hNfpdm2Kn25JcjxGCFcH